Censoring Christmas

"The Gap is censoring the word Christmas, pure and simple. Yet the company wants all the people who celebrate Christmas to do their shopping at its stores?" AFA says. "Until Gap proves it recognizes Christmas by using it in their newspaper, radio, television advertising or in-store signage, the boycott will be promoted."

However, a recent ad by Gap mentions Christmas along with Hanukkah, Kwanzaa, and Solstice. Technically, this should be enough to break the boycott. So, the AFA is conducting a poll asking whether the boycott should continue now that the Gap has a commercial with "a cavalier approach to Christmas" that "compares Christmas to the pagan holiday called 'Solstice' … celebrated by Wiccans who practice witchcraft!"
